Beefheart eventually formed a new Magic Band with a group of younger musicians and regained critical approval through three final albums: Shiny Beast 1978 , Doc at the Radar Station 1980 and Ice Cream for Crow 1982.

The live session recorded in Los Angeles in November 1967 not in August 1965 as the jacket claims was released - maimed - years later, on the album Mirror Man Buddha, 1971 , and surfaced in its original version after thirty years on Mirror Man Sessions Buddha, 1999.

In 1971, as result of a violent fight, the two geniuses of Los Angeles, Captain Beefheart and Frank Zappa, become estranged for good, a great loss for Beefheart's free blues. The end of Mirror Man consists of fifteen minutes of anarchical improvisation, a free-jazz jam for four wrecked blues men, in which the instrument that astonishes the most, in its brilliant genius, is Beefheart's voice. In order to realize that crazy deformation, that spatial-temporal warping, that apocalyptic and blasphemous perspective, Van Vliet exploited his outrageous vocal versatility that allowed him to impersonate all kinds of different and extreme characters in a subliminal performance of schizophrenia, often within the same piece, and to visit states of psychic depression and hallucination with all the grace of a charging rhinoceros. Here the emphasis is more on the lyrics than the instrumentation.
The music of these jams is a blues regressed to a barbaric stage: on one hand the band plays in a childish way, indulging in false notes and playing out of time; on the other hand the singer lashes out, drools, swears and spews with a hoarse, choked and rusty voice. In a way this is his most intellectual work, because the album takes the traditional topics of blues, eroticism, freedom, trains and nostalgia, and sets them in a modern context of city alienation.
